1. A tamper-proof lock system for protecting the stem of a fire hydrant or similar apparatus against unauthorized turning thereof, said system comprising:

  • A. a cap assembly mountable on said stem and including a cap housing whose head has a circular array of sloped faces formed thereon, the housing having a central inner cavity dimensioned to receive and socket said stem whereby rotation of said housing causes rotation of said stem and a Saturn ring encircling said housing and linked thereto for relative rotation, andB. a wrench cooperating with said cap assembly, said wrench having at least two sloped faces adapted to complement and engage corresponding faces in said array thereof on said cap housing, and a fixed claw cooperating with an adjustable claw to grip said Saturn ring to provide purchase.
